The One Tun started trading on this site in 1759, although the current building was built in the 1870s. Dickens immortalised it as Bill Sykes’s local in Oliver Twist. These days it attracts a less criminal crowd, and serves excellent pan-Asian food. There are also hotel rooms upstairs.
